What drives this work

Financial literacy shouldn't be a luxury reserved for people with economics degrees. Everyone deserves to understand their money—how it works, where it goes, and how to make it serve their goals.

Yet traditional financial services often feel designed to confuse rather than clarify. Hidden fees, jargon-heavy explanations, and advice that seems tailored more to the advisor's commission than the client's benefit.

We built our practice on a different model: transparency, plain language, and fee-based consulting that removes the incentive to push products you don't need.

How we work

Our sessions are structured but not scripted. We follow a framework that ensures we cover essential ground—your income, expenses, goals, concerns—but we adapt based on what matters most to you.

Some clients need help with immediate debt relief. Others are focused on long-term wealth building. A few just want someone to review their plan and confirm they're not missing anything critical. We meet people where they are.

After each consultation, you walk away with a written plan and clear action steps. No ambiguity, no "talk to your accountant and figure it out." We give you the roadmap; you decide how fast to follow it.

Our philosophy on money

Money is a tool, not an end in itself. It's there to enable the life you want—whether that's security, freedom, generosity, or all three. But to use it effectively, you need to understand how it moves through your life.

We don't believe in one-size-fits-all strategies. A 25-year-old with student debt and career ambitions has different priorities than a 50-year-old preparing for retirement. Our advice reflects that reality.

We also don't believe in creating dependency. Our goal is to educate you so that over time, you need us less, not more. That might sound counterintuitive for a business, but we'd rather build trust than lock you into perpetual consulting.

What you won't find here

We don't sell financial products. We're not affiliated with investment platforms, insurance companies, or banks. We don't earn commissions on recommendations.

This independence matters. It means when we suggest a course of action, it's because it makes sense for your situation—not because it triggers a payout for us.

You also won't find pressure tactics or artificial urgency. If you're not ready to move forward after a consultation, that's fine. Our advice remains valid whether you act on it tomorrow or six months from now.
